Output 2aeb581cc1934028a99b84d58de2dc9ec6fa81cfe9e115774e15c06d8e0e878e:0

value
867242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5edfc652629d16724a1f253b76e2bc4168966e3 OP_EQUAL
address
3JGyKpKA4uGhyPvZ1Lz1SDik4QU76k6exC
transaction
2aeb581cc1934028a99b84d58de2dc9ec6fa81cfe9e115774e15c06d8e0e878e
spent
true